Katelyn Miller, on October 14, 2007, said:
In my and probably others’ opinions, Birmingham is just more commercial than residential. Birmingham is just seen as a downtown area. People’s perspectives on Birmingham are that it is a place to commute to for their job and commute out of to go to their home. Most people would like to live on the outskirts of the city because it can offer them many things that the inner city cannot. For example, families in the inner-city can’t have outdoor pets, pools, gardens, lots of land/open space, or live in a subdivision. People want things that living in the city can’t offer them so they want to live in the suburbs.
